Senior Backend Developer (rust/typescript) – Fintech?payments

Remote, GB, United Kingdom

Job Description

About Us



We are an early?stage, venture?backed payments startup on a mission to make global money movement instantaneous, secure, and affordable. Built by alumni from leading fintechs and cloud?native scale?ups, we process card and account?to?account transactions for merchants in 30+ countries. Regulatory compliance, security?by?design, and a developer?centric culture are the cornerstones of our product and platform.

What You'll Do



As a Senior Backend Engineer, you'll play a critical role in building and scaling our high-performance, serverless infrastructure. Your work will directly power systems handling thousands of payment requests per second, with a strong focus on automation, security and observability.

-

Backend Architecture & Development (35%)



Design and build event-driven microservices using Rust (for high-throughput cores) and TypeScript (for edge and orchestration layers). Architect systems capable of handling thousands of concurrent payment requests per second.

-

CI/CD & GitOps Ownership (15%)



Implement and maintain GitOps workflows using GitHub Actions and Argo CD. Ensure code is deployed to production within 15 minutes of PR merge, with support for automated rollbacks.

-

Security & Compliance (15%)



Embed DevSecOps best practices into the development process. Implement and manage security controls aligned with PCI-DSS v4.0, GDPR, SOC 2, and ISO 27001.

-

Infrastructure as Code (10%)



Automate infrastructure using Terraform and CDK. Maintain repeatable, least-privilege environments across multiple AWS regions.

-

Observability & Performance (10%)



Champion structured logging, distributed tracing, and metrics collection. Benchmark performance to maintain P99 latencies under 100ms.

-

API Documentation (10%)



Generate and maintain OpenAPI 3.1 documentation. Integrate tools like Redocly and Spectral into the CI pipeline for automated API docs.

-

Mentorship & Technical Leadership (5%)



Review pull requests, mentor junior engineers, and contribute to the technical roadmap and coding standards.

Tech Stack Snapshot



- Languages: Rust 1.80+, TypeScript 5.x

- Compute: AWS Lambda, Fargate, Cloudflare Workers

- Messaging/Eventing: Amazon?SNS/SQS, EventBridge, Kafka (MSK)

- Data: Postgres (Aurora Serverless?v2), DynamoDB, S3.

- IaC & DevOps: Terraform, AWS?CDK, GitHub Actions, Renovate, Trivy.

- GitOps & CI/CD: Argo?CD (pull?based), Flux v2, GitHub Actions, OpenFeature gates.

- API Documentation: OpenAPI?3.1, Redocly, Spectral, Dredd for contract testing.

- Security & Edge: Cloudflare Zero Trust, WAF, mTLS, OIDC.

- Observability: OpenTelemetry, Grafana, Loki.

- Compliance Tooling: Drata, Prowler, HashiCorp Vault.

You'll Thrive Here If You Have



- 5+?years building cloud?native back?end systems in a strongly typed language (Rust, Go, Java, etc.) with at least 1?year production Rust experience.

- Deep knowledge of event?driven architectures (idempotency, exactly?once delivery, saga patterns).

- Proven delivery of Serverless or container?based workloads at scale.

- Hands?on GitOps & CI/CD mindset (Argo?CD, Flux, GitHub Actions) with automated testing & progressive delivery.

- Solid experience with Infrastructure?as?Code (Terraform or CDK) and DevSecOps practices, security tests left of boom.

- Experience implementing or operating under PCI?DSS, GDPR, SOC?2, or ISO?27001 controls.

- Comfortable working in a fast?moving startup, collaborating asynchronously across time zones.

Bonus Points



- Payments industry background (card acquiring, issuing, open banking).

- Knowledge of Cloudflare Workers/Pages, Durable Objects, and Zero Trust policies.

- Familiarity with Zero?knowledge or privacy?enhancing cryptography.

- Community involvement (open?source maintainer, conference speaker, tech blogger).

What We Offer



- Competitive salary and benefits package.

- Opportunity to work on cutting-edge technologies at the intersection of AI, payment solutions and event-driven systems.

- Collaborative, fast-paced environment that values innovation and impact.

- Potential for significant influence on product direction and company success.

Hiring Process



- Intro call (30?min) - meet CTO, talk role & culture.

- Technical deep?dive (90?min) - architecture discussion & code review (no take?home).

- Pairing session (60?min) - solve a real but small problem together in Rust/TS.

- Founders chat (30?min) - product vision & values fit.

- Offer - references & background check.

Average timeline:

2?weeks

from first call to offer.

Secure payments deserve secure code, come build the future with us!

Job Type: Full-time

Pay: 70,000.00-100,000.00 per year

Benefits:

Company pension Work from home
Experience:

Back-end development: 5 years (preferred)
Work Location: Remote

Beware of fraud agents! do not pay money to get a job

MNCJobs.co.uk will not be responsible for any payment made to a third-party. All Terms of Use are applicable.


Related Jobs

Job Detail

  • Job Id
    JD3484559
  • Industry
    Not mentioned
  • Total Positions
    1
  • Job Type:
    Full Time
  • Salary:
    Not mentioned
  • Employment Status
    Full Time
  • Job Location
    Remote, GB, United Kingdom
  • Education
    Not mentioned